About Us


At Youngblood Youth Development Homes & Services, Inc., we provide transitional living and supportive services for youth ages 16–22 who are preparing for independent adulthood. Our mission is to empower young people through safe housing, mentorship, education, and life skills training, helping them build confidence and stability for the future. We are a trusted community organization dedicated to promoting growth, resilience, and lasting change.


Position Summary


We’re seeking a dedicated and organized Case Coordinator to manage all aspects of resident care—from admission and orientation to discharge and transition. This role ensures that program requirements, documentation, and services are completed accurately and on time, while maintaining a supportive environment that helps youth thrive.


Key Responsibilities


Admissions & Orientation


  • Welcome and orient new residents.

  • Complete intake forms, inventories, and documentation.

  • Submit admission paperwork within 24 hours.

  • Conduct assessments and biopsychosocial evaluations within 7 days.

  • Develop individualized Program Plans within 14 days of admission.

Case Management & Resident Support


  • Conduct weekly one-on-one check-ins and document progress.

  • Submit weekly and monthly reports on schedule.

  • Coordinate medical, dental, vision, and mental health appointments.

  • Respond to communication (calls, emails, texts) within 24 hours.

  • Attend case planning meetings and collaborate with partners.

  • Monitor academic and behavioral progress.

Crisis & Incident Response


  • Report and document incidents promptly and accurately.

  • Notify leadership and case managers according to policy.

Collaboration & Program Development


  • Work with healthcare providers, counselors, and community resources.

  • Participate in staff meetings and planning sessions.

  • Organize at least one monthly guest speaker session.

  • Support residents in accessing family and community connections.

Transportation & Documentation


  • Safely transport residents to appointments, work, or activities.

  • Maintain accurate logs, records, and resident files.

Discharge Planning


  • Begin discharge planning at admission.

  • Complete discharge checklist within 24 hours of departure.

  • Follow up to ensure a smooth transition to independent living.

Qualifications


  • Bachelor’s degree in Social Work, Human Services, Psychology, or related field (preferred).

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in youth services, residential care, or case management.

  • Strong communication, organization, and documentation skills.

  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ively.

  • Valid driver’s license and clean driving record required.
